Kym Karath was only five years old when she rose to stardom as Gretl, the youngest member of the Von Trapp children in the iconic movie musical The Sound of Music. But in a revealing new interview with the UK's Times, Karath revealed the devastating reason she decided to quit acting for some time in the years following the film's tremendous success.
While she struggled in school due to bullying, Karath found success on popular TV series like Lassie, Peyton Place,and The Brady Bunch. But as she got older, the dark side of Hollywood reared its ugly head.
(Photo by Screen Archives/Getty Images)
“After I did Brady Bunch, I was 13 going on 18, in terms of looking very physically mature. There were some very scary offers and pedophile-ish people who were circulating,” said Karath, who alleged that she was raped at 15 by a film producer, according to the Times piece. “I heard some stories from somebody who was in a position to know — there were other young people.”
Karath said she felt like she couldn't tell anyone what had happened.
“But my parents kind of figured out what happened,” she continued. “I couldn’t say much to them because I was afraid my father would go and literally murder the guy and I didn’t want my dad to go to jail.”
Instead, her parents determined, “No more acting, just focus on school.”
Looking back, she realized, “It was the safe thing to do. It was really a terrible, frightening period of time.”

Karath went on to graduate from the University of Southern California. While she did explore acting once again, she found that not much had changed.
“It was still full of all that — a million propositions: ‘If you really want this role, you need to come to my hotel room,’” she said. “It wasn’t fun. And I felt I was too emotionally fragile after my father died to make my way through all of that.”
She went on to movie to Paris and found love.

When Karath's son Eric was three weeks old, he contracted viral meningitis and was left severely brain-damaged.
“I have not gone back to acting quite honestly because my son is really the center of my life,” Karath said. “He lives with me, he’s 34 and needs me. I can’t drop everything to go to auditions.”
She founded the Aurelia Foundation and Creative Steps Program for young adults with disabilities. Back in 2013, Karath told Parade that she also serves as an advocate for other parents navigating the journey.
“My son has special needs, so I was needed in a way I never expected to be needed and …you just rise to the occasion,” Karath explained.
